How do I free up storage space on my Windows 11 PC?
Manual cleanup means you personally decide which files to delete, rather than letting an automated tool do it. This gives you more control and is actually safer than automatic tools because you can see exactly what you're removing for free up storage on Windows 11 PC.
Step-by-Step Manual Cleanup
1. Empty the Recycle Bin
Right-click the Recycle Bin icon on your desktop
Select Empty Recycle Bin
Click Yes to confirm
2. Clear Browser Cache (Chrome as example)
Open Chrome
Click the three dots (top right) → Settings
Privacy and security → Clear browsing data
Set Time range to "All time"
Check only "Cached images and files" (uncheck passwords and history)
Click Clear data
3. Delete Temporary Files Manually
Press Windows + R on your keyboard
Type %temp% and press Enter
Press Ctrl + A to select everything
Press Delete on your keyboard
If any files say "in use," click Skip — that's normal
Empty Recycle Bin afterward
